@@mico_wrlddd It feels slower, shooting is more realistic so basically how ps4 was before the patch. You might want to turn off the haptic feedback on the controller. The triggers tighten up like if your stamina is low the R2 stiffens so you can't waste anymore, if you post up and the defender is strong the L2 button tightens up. It's a neat feature but when you're playing park or triple threat you can sprint all game without consequence I think it's best used in the actual nba games. Honestly if you look at videos of the game it looks similar but I swear I feel like I'm playing 2k14 all over again when you played the ps3 version then the ps4 version where animations were similar and gameplay but it felt smoother. Movement is realistic you can't just sprint up and shoot dudes actually have to plant their feet. Same on defense I feel like you're better in the paint on ps5 but also mistiming layups is insane.
